❖ Unit Tangent Vector at a Given Point ❖

In this video, we explore how to find a unit tangent vector for a space curve at a specific value of
t!

🌐✏️ While the concept of a tangent vector is similar in 3D as it is in 2D, the calculations can be a bit more complex.

I’ll walk you through the step-by-step process to determine the unit tangent vector, ensuring that it has a magnitude of 1. This is a fundamental concept in vector calculus, essential for understanding motion along curves.

What You’ll Learn:

The definition of a unit tangent vector
How to compute the tangent vector for space curves
Steps to normalize the tangent vector to ensure a magnitude of 1
Real-world applications of unit tangent vectors in physics and engineering
